Geneva invite for Bates masterclass

The second Geneva masterclass with Foden's horn star Jonathan Bates will be held in Stockton on Tees later this month — and all are welcome.

Geneva
  The masterclass will be led by Foden's horn star Jonathan Bates

Following the successful take up for their first Bandroom & Concert Masterclass, this weekend with jazz virtuoso Steve Waterman, Geneva Instruments will be holding their second event at their Stockton on Tees bandroom and showroom on Saturday 15th December (TS18 2SG).

It will be led by Foden's solo horn Jonathan Bates and will start at 1.00pm and finish at 4.00pm.

Tips and play

The first event with jazz virtuoso Steve Waterman is sure to be great success (1.00pm — 4.00pm on Saturday 8th December), and so it will be the turn of one of the Geneva Artist and one of the brass band movement's finest horn players impart his advice in a friendly open forum, where participants can ask questions, gain tips, play and even try out Geneva instruments for themselves.

Discussion

There will also be a discussion on performance anxiety and nervousness — an area that many players at all levels are finding is offering a great benefit to their enjoyment of playing.
